Output 3d26e7c18734fc74c6541ba789a9280fab30131ac0d26b08d0c69ad2e3612b86:5

value
900000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f05413a36adfca48eec6dd471d729e4696f075e8 OP_EQUAL
address
3PbkpLQffEtTa5gCPfUXKenj1QrH6bJ7Eu
transaction
3d26e7c18734fc74c6541ba789a9280fab30131ac0d26b08d0c69ad2e3612b86
spent
true